Trey invites Kristof Gleich, together they discuss a wide range of topics, including factor frameworks, advancements in behavior analytics, the qualities that set exceptional money managers apart, and more!
Kristof is the President and CIO of Harbor Capital and is responsible for Harbor’s $40B of AUM invested in boutique managers from across the World. Prior to Harbor, Kristof worked at Goldman Sachs and JP Morgan.
